Emma Stone wins 2nd Best Actress Oscar for ‘Poor Things’
Image Source:
LOS ANGELES (AP) — Emma Stone clinched her second career-best actress Oscar for her outstanding performance in "Poor Things," edging out intense competition from Lily Gladstone of "Killers of the Flower Moon" in a race that kept pundits on the edge of their seats.
Stone, visibly stunned, emerged victorious on Sunday night, as announced by last year's winner, Michelle Yeoh. This historic win, as Gladstone would have been the first Native American to secure a competitive Oscar.
Stone expressed her disbelief in her acceptance speech, stating, "I think I blacked out... I still feel like I’m spinning a little bit." She thanked her husband, Dave McCary, her co-stars, and the director, acknowledging the collaborative effort that brought the film to life.
